Transaction df1062575d264dbe48d464c2ef5c9022ebf5acd33b6e7c30292299f125ee3b6c

71 Input
2 Outputs
  • df1062575d264dbe48d464c2ef5c9022ebf5acd33b6e7c30292299f125ee3b6c:0
  • value  1646333194
    address  364DGZeqtssW1cmgYb7jAvPArJBrWEd6Sc
  • df1062575d264dbe48d464c2ef5c9022ebf5acd33b6e7c30292299f125ee3b6c:1
  • value  31157459
    address  36yj3rCtkiVj8GaRFU6dbjSduKuhiouhSu